New ⁤Zealand Needs a Firm Stance on Gaza: Academic Urges ⁤Action Beyond Trump’s Influence

Introduction

In recent discussions ⁣surrounding the conflict in Gaza, an academic has emphasized that New Zealand must adopt a more assertive approach. The call for ⁣action highlights the importance of moving beyond diplomatic hesitation, especially in light of global political dynamics influenced by figures like Donald Trump.

The Current Landscape

The situation in Gaza continues to escalate, with humanitarian needs reaching critical ⁢levels. ‍Recent statistics indicate that over two million people are facing severe ‍shortages of ⁣essential resources such as ​food and medical supplies. This dire scenario demands not only acknowledgment but also a decisive response from‌ nations around⁢ the world, including New Zealand.

Urgent Need ⁢for Leadership

The academic argues that New Zealand’s current stance may appear indecisive and overly cautious. ⁤Rather than “tip-toeing” around complex geopolitical relationships, ​particularly ‍those affected by​ hyper-partisan figures like Trump, Kiwis should adopt​ a clear and principled policy regarding Gaza.

Rethinking Foreign Policy

New Zealand has traditionally prided itself on taking ethical stands during ⁤international crises. However, there is growing concern that this reputation could falter if no strong statement ⁤or ⁢action is undertaken soon.⁤ A re-evaluation of foreign‌ policy⁣ related to conflict zones like Gaza is essential for ensuring that humanitarian considerations take precedence ⁣over political relationships.

Example from Recent Events:

To ⁣illustrate this point further, we can draw parallels⁤ with other countries such as Canada which ‌have taken definitive stances based on human rights advocacy,—even at economic costs—demonstrating how leadership can ⁣emerge ⁢amid adversity.

call for ⁢Solidarity and Action

As global perceptions shift around conflicts involving Israel and Palestine, it becomes increasingly vital for nations to express solidarity through tangible actions rather than⁣ mere rhetoric. This could involve advocating at international platforms or providing support through non-governmental organizations dedicated to alleviating suffering in war-torn​ areas.

Implications for Diplomacy:

By not taking firm stances when faced with human rights violations elsewhere in the world—like those seen currently in Gaza—New Zealand risks losing‍ credibility within the international community as a peace-oriented nation committed to humanitarian values.

Conclusion

academics urge⁣ New Zealand leaders to step up‌ their stance regarding the ongoing ​crisis in Gaza⁣ decisively. An unequivocal commitment—not shaped primary by external influences⁣ such as former ‍U.S President Trump’s lingering shadow—is necessary if New Zealand intends to remain ‌true‌ to its identity ‌as a nation grounded in principles of justice and empathy toward global citizens facing hardships.
